IMPORTANT POINTS TO REMEMBER AT THE TIME OF PERFORMING ‘SIEVE ANALYSIS’ TEST AT SITE.
there is a huge difference between performing a test in laboratory and in real site condition , and for a civil engineers the site condition could be anything from advanced to normal but as a civil engineer we have to perform the test as accurate as possible and for that some of the points which are important for sieve analysis test at site are listed below:
1) Sample shall be brought to an air dry condition before
weighing and sieving. this may be achieved either by drying at room temperature
or by heating at temperature 100 OC to 110 OC in oven.
2) Sample is weighed accurately.
3) The air dry sample shall be sieved successively on
appropriate size starting with largest care shall be taken to ensure that
sieves are clean before use.
4) Each sieve is shaken separately for period not less than
two minutes.
5) Care should be taken that sieve net is not ruptured or
damage.
6) Care should be taken to clean the sieve, so that
particles do not block the sieve net.
7) Precaution should be taken that material should not be
overloaded & should not overflow while sieving.
8) Do not force any material through the sieve.
9) Record the weight retained on each sieve.
10) Fineness modulus is sum of cumulative % retained on each
sieve (up to 150 mic.) divided by 100.
11) Minimum weight required for sieving.
20 mm = 2.00 kg. , 10 mm = 0.50 kg. , 4.75 = 0.20 kg,
